On hierarchical server-based communication with switched Ethernet

Ethernet is becoming a common network technology for industrial and factory automation systems and, in recent years, a big effort has been made in enabling real-time communications using Ethernet technology. Many of these systems are complex, extend over relatively large places and/or integrate a significant number of nodes, thus requiring the use of multiple switches (hop). In this paper we look into the usage of Flexible Time-Triggered (FTT) enabled Ethernet switches in this class of systems, more specifically using the recently proposed server-based scheduling mechanism supported by this protocol. The paper proposes and validates a resource reservation protocol, presents a method for computing the end-to-end deadlines and discusses possible strategies for the deadline partitioning. 1

[1]  R. Santos,et al.  A synthesizable ethernet switch with enhanced real-time features , 2009, 2009 35th Annual Conference of IEEE Industrial Electronics.

[2]  Thomas Nolte,et al.  Flexible, efficient and robust real-time communication with server-based Ethernet Switching , 2010, 2010 IEEE International Workshop on Factory Communication Systems Proceedings.

[3]  L. Almeida,et al.  Enhancing real-time communication over cots ethernet switches , 2006, 2006 IEEE International Workshop on Factory Communication Systems.

[4]  Thomas Nolte,et al.  Share-Driven Scheduling of Embedded Networks , 2006 .

[5]  Luís Almeida,et al.  Message routing in multi-segment FTT networks: the isochronous approach , 2004, 18th International Parallel and Distributed Processing Symposium, 2004. Proceedings..

[6]  Giorgio C. Buttazzo,et al.  FTT-Ethernet: a flexible real-time communication protocol that supports dynamic QoS management on Ethernet-based systems , 2005, IEEE Transactions on Industrial Informatics.

[7]  Srinidhi Varadarajan Experiences with EtheReal: a fault-tolerant real-time Ethernet switch , 2001, ETFA 2001. 8th International Conference on Emerging Technologies and Factory Automation. Proceedings (Cat. No.01TH8597).

[8]  Tzi-cker Chiueh,et al.  Ethereal: a fault tolerant host-transparent mechanism for bandwidth guarantees over switched ethernet networks , 2000 .

[9]  Wang Yi,et al.  Uppaal in a nutshell , 1997, International Journal on Software Tools for Technology Transfer.

[10]  Junghoon Lee,et al.  An error control scheme for Ethernet-based real-time communication , 1996, Proceedings of 3rd International Workshop on Real-Time Computing Systems and Applications.

[11]  Paulo Pedreiras,et al.  Approaches to Enforce Real-Time Behavior in Ethernet , 2005 .

[12]  Paolo Gai,et al.  FTT-Ethernet: a platform to implement the Elastic Task Model over message streams , 2002, 4th IEEE International Workshop on Factory Communication Systems.

[13]  Thomas Nolte,et al.  Server-based real-time communications of Switched Ethernet , 2008 .

[14]  Tzi-cker Chiueh,et al.  EtheReal: a host-transparent real-time Fast Ethernet switch , 1998, Proceedings Sixth International Conference on Network Protocols (Cat. No.98TB100256).

[15]  L. Almeida,et al.  Designing a costumized Ethernet switch for safe hard real-time communication , 2008, 2008 IEEE International Workshop on Factory Communication Systems.

[16]  Thomas Nolte,et al.  Improving the efficiency of Ethernet switches for real-time communication , 2010 .

[17]  Jian Shi,et al.  Hard Real-Time Communication over Multi-hop Switched Ethernet , 2008, 2008 International Conference on Networking, Architecture, and Storage.

[18]  Max Felser Real-Time Ethernet for Automation Applications. , 2009 .

[19]  Jean-Dominique Decotignie,et al.  Ethernet-Based Real-Time and Industrial Communications , 2005, Proceedings of the IEEE.

[20]  Thomas Nolte,et al.  Implementing Server-Based Communication within Ethernet Switches , 2009 .

[21]  Magnus Jonsson,et al.  Switched real-time ethernet with earliest deadline first scheduling protocols and traffic handling , 2002, Proceedings 16th International Parallel and Distributed Processing Symposium.

[22]  Nicolas Rivierre,et al.  Real-time communications over broadcast networks : the CSMA-DCR and the DOD-CSMA-CD protocols , 1993 .

[23]  Magnus Jonsson,et al.  Switched Real-Time Ethernet in Industrial Applications - Asymmetric Deadline Partitioning Scheme , 2003 .

[24]  Henning Schulzrinne,et al.  Real-time communication in packet-switched networks , 1994, Proc. IEEE.